The Lviv-based "Rukh" is participating in the UEFA Youth League season 2023/2024 among U-19 teams, having become the winner of the previous championship of Ukraine.

Within the first round of the Champions Path countries, the yellow-and-black team hosted Bosnian "Sarajevo" in the Polish city of Stalowa Wola.

The match ended in a draw — 1:1. After conceding in the first half, Rukh equalized after halftime thanks to Andriy Kiteley's penalty goal.

The return leg will take place in Sarajevo on October 25.

UEFA Youth League. Champions Path countries

Round 1. First match

"Rukh" (U-19) — "Sarajevo" (U-19) — 1:1 (0:1)

Goals: Kiteley (66, from the penalty spot) — Nurkovic (23).

"Rukh" (U-19): Bakus, Kiteley, Turkov, Khолод, Popovskyi, Boyko, Pastukh, Denysov (Shtokal, 88), Kasarda (Shaida, 67), Panchenko (Muzhychuk, 82), Kvas.

Yellow card: Kiteley (90+4).

In case of success at this stage, in the second round Lvivians will face the winner of the duel between "Famalicao" (Portugal) — "Midtjylland" (Denmark).
